> The future move of pin-init to `syn` uncovers the following private
> intra-doc link:
>
> error: public documentation for `Devres` links to private item `Self::inner`
> --> rust/kernel/devres.rs:106:7
> |
> 106 | /// [`Self::inner`] is guaranteed to be initialized and is always accessed read-only.
> | ^^^^^^^^^^^ this item is private
> |
> = note: this link will resolve properly if you pass `--document-private-items`
> = note: `-D rustdoc::private-intra-doc-links` implied by `-D warnings`
> = help: to override `-D warnings` add `#[allow(rustdoc::private_intra_doc_links)]`
>
> Currently, when rendered, the link points to "nowhere" (an inexistent
> anchor for a "method").
>
> Thus fix it.
